  • Page 7: Thermostat Settings

    9/3/2015 THERMOSTAT SETTINGS The thermostat has a preset temperature of 39° Fahrenheit with a 4° differential from the factory. To display target set point. In programming mode it selects a parameter or confirms an operation. To start manual defrost. In programming mode it browses the parameter codes or increases the displayed value.
  • Page 8 9/3/2015 HOW TO SEE THE SET POINT 1. Push and immediately release the SET key. The set point will be shown. 2. Push and immediately release the SET key or wait about 5 seconds to return to normal visualization. HOW TO CHANGE THE SETPOINT 1.

  • Page 10: Stainless Steel And General Cleaning

    9/3/2015 STAINLESS STEEL AND GENERAL CLEANING Stainless Steel and Aluminum:  Piper only approves soap and water for cleaning stainless steel.  NOTICE: Do NOT use chlorinated cleaners. General Surfaces, Fiberglass:  Clean surfaces with a soft cloth or sponge utilizing a mild detergent. Rinse completely with warm water and then dry.
